The Limitations of Traditional Reading Habits

Your current reading habits were likely formed organically, perhaps in early education. These methods, while foundational, were not optimized for the information-rich environment of the 21st century. Think of trying to navigate a superhighway with the rules of a single-lane country road. You’re bottlenecked by habits that were never designed for the volume and pace you now face.

Habitual Regression: The Silent Time Thief

One of the most common culprits is regression, the unconscious habit of rereading words, phrases, or even entire sentences. This is akin to a car repeatedly braking and accelerating, wasting fuel and time for no additional progress. Your eyes, conditioned to retrace their steps, are like a restless cartographer constantly redrawing the same lines on their map.

Subvocalization: The Inner Monologue Slowdown

Another significant factor is subvocalization, the silent pronunciation of words in your head as you read. This limits your reading speed to your speaking speed, which is considerably slower than your potential processing speed. It’s like trying to send a high-speed data packet through a dial-up modem. The information is there, but the conduit is too narrow.

Fixation Points: The Eyeballs Stuck in Neutral

Your eyes don’t glide smoothly across a page; they jump from point to point, called fixations. The average reader makes many fixations per line, often on consecutive words. This is like a pedestrian stopping at every single blade of grass on a long walk instead of taking measured strides.

Visual Training Techniques: Re-engineering Your Gaze

At the heart of many speed reading programs are techniques designed to alter how your eyes scan and process text. These are not about forcing your eyes to move faster, but about making their movements more efficient and encompassing.

Expanding Peripheral Vision: The Wide-Angle Lens

One key technique involves exercises to widen your peripheral vision while reading. Instead of focusing on individual words, you learn to take in chunks of text at each fixation. This is like switching from a narrow focus lens to a wide-angle one, capturing more of the scene in a single frame.

Reducing Fixations: The Efficient Leap

The institute aims to reduce the number of fixations per line. Instead of stopping on every word, you’ll learn to make fewer, broader leaps. This is similar to a seasoned traveler who knows the most efficient routes, bypassing unnecessary detours.

Minimizing Regression: Breaking the Cycle of Doubt

Through guided practice, you’ll work to overcome the ingrained habit of rereading. This involves building confidence in your initial comprehension and recognizing that constant backtracking is a drain on efficiency. It’s about trusting your first read, like a skilled navigator trusting their compass.

Cognitive Strategies: Optimizing Your Mental Framework

Speed reading is as much about how your brain processes information as it is about how your eyes move. The institute integrates cognitive strategies to enhance comprehension during faster reading.

Chunking and Grouping: Building Information Blocks

You’ll learn techniques to group words into meaningful chunks, extracting the core idea of a phrase or sentence rather than processing each word in isolation. This is like reading a telegram; you understand the message by grouping related words, not by deciphering each letter individually.

Identifying Key Information: The Art of the Signal Flare

Training will focus on developing your ability to quickly identify keywords, topic sentences, and crucial transition words. These act as signposts, guiding your understanding through the text with greater speed and accuracy. It’s like being able to spot the most prominent stars in a constellation, immediately grasping its shape.

Active Recall and Summarization: Solidifying Understanding

The institute may incorporate exercises that encourage active recall and summarization immediately after reading. This reinforces comprehension and helps to solidify the information in your long-term memory, proving that speed reading is not about superficial acquaintance but about deep understanding.

The Role of Technology and Tools

While the core of speed reading lies in learned techniques, technology and various tools can significantly aid in the learning process and ongoing practice. Think of these tools as the sophisticated instruments that accompany a skilled artisan.

Software and Apps for Speed Reading Training

Numerous software programs and mobile applications are designed to guide you through speed reading exercises. These often incorporate features like metronome pacing, controlled eye movement drills, and progress tracking.

Pacing Tools: The Steady Drumbeat

Many applications use a virtual metronome or display words at a controlled pace. This encourages you to keep up and prevents falling back into slow, habitual reading patterns. It provides a consistent rhythm to your reading, like a conductor leading an orchestra.

Visualizers and Eye Movement Trackers

Some advanced tools might attempt to visualize your eye movements or even provide feedback on fixation points, helping you identify areas for improvement. These act as an optometrist for your reading habits, diagnosing and prescribing corrections.
